Understanding Drug Sales


Medicine sales involve the advertising and selling of medical products and healthcare products to medical professionals, including physicians, druggists, and health institutions. These sales are vital in delivering important details about drug benefits, side effects, and appropriate use to ensure that healthcare providers can make knowledgeable choices for their patients. The position requires both a deep understanding of the products but also a strong ability to convey information well and foster relationships within the healthcare industry.

Skills for Successful Sales Reps


To excel in pharmaceutical sales, excellent communication skills are paramount. Successful sales reps need to convey complex scientific information clearly and concisely. They must engage healthcare professionals in significant discussions, making it essential to adapt their communication style to different audiences. Building rapport and trust with physicians is crucial, as this contributes to the credibility of the pharmaceutical products under promotion.


Alongside communication, strong time management and organizational skills are vital for success in this field. Sales reps often manage dozens of accounts and need to prioritize their visits wisely. By organizing their schedules and maintaining detailed records of interactions, including follow-ups, they ensure consistent engagement with healthcare providers. This level of organization not only enhances productivity but also leads to more successful outcomes for sales efforts.


Ultimately, a solid understanding of the pharmaceutical industry and regulatory environment is necessary to achieve effective selling. Knowledge of current trends, competitor products, and compliance regulations equips sales reps to position their products effectively.
